Siteserve's share register for the period before its sale is to be made public from today.
It comes after it emerged the company, which was sold to a Denis O'Brien-owned firm Millington in 2012 at a loss of €100m to the tax payer, saw a sharp rise in shares swapping hands in the month before the first bids for the firm were received by IBRC.
Yesterday, Fianna Fáil leader Micháel Martin said the trading activity at Siteserv before its sale raised "serious questions".
According to the Irish Independent, Siteserv liquidator Kieran Wallace is to make the document available on request from as early as this morning.
